Output 3ab9440eca6b39861cc6dfe930349bdf5560134919ef6615caee20c9f0db2872:12

value
29453
script pubkey
OP_0 OP_PUSHBYTES_20 ccc3ae02e217f552428f609608b5fced032e2573
address
bc1qenp6uqhzzl64ys50vztq3d0ua5pjuftny27sy9
transaction
3ab9440eca6b39861cc6dfe930349bdf5560134919ef6615caee20c9f0db2872